Third-party data processors that help us deliver Pharmacy HQ.
This is the authoritative list. Where the Terms of Service or Privacy Policy reference sub-processors generally, they defer to this page. We update this page whenever a sub-processor is added, removed, or changes its role.
Pharmacy HQ is operated by Pharmacy HQ Pty Ltd (ACN 698 203 164 · ABN 86 698 203 164), with registered office C/- Perrier Ryan Business Advisors, Level 1, 30 Lisburn Street, East Brisbane QLD 4169 (hello@pharmacyhq.com.au). To deliver the service we rely on the third-party data processors listed below. Each provides a specific infrastructure or processing capability that Pharmacy HQ itself does not run in-house.
These process data for every Pharmacy HQ pharmacy.

| Google Cloud (Firebase) United States · global presence |
Hosting, authentication, database, file storage, Cloud Functions, scheduled jobs | All operational data (tasks, patients, deliveries, orders, staff records, audit logs). Live data sits in the Realtime Database; file uploads (slips, certificates, photos) sit in Firebase Storage. Auth handles staff sign-in + MFA. |
| Stripe, Inc. United States · global presence |
Subscription billing + payment processing | Customer billing email, payment method, subscription state, invoice history. Stripe is the source of truth for which tier each pharmacy is on; we mirror only the non-sensitive subscription state into Pharmacy HQ. |
| Resend United States (with Tokyo region) |
Transactional email delivery | Welcome emails, password resets, trial expiry warnings, invitation emails, claim-nag reminders. Domain pharmacyhq.com.au is verified in Resend. |
| Cloudflare, Inc. United States · global edge |
DNS, Email Routing, Workers | DNS hosting for pharmacyhq.com.au. Email Routing receives inbound automated reports (fridge temperature logs from Clever Logger, dead-stock wholesaler emails). The Worker parses these and forwards to our Cloud Functions for ingestion. |
| Anthropic PBC United States |
AI assistant (Claude API) | Powers the in-app AI surfaces (Help Chat, Policy Chat, Workflow Chat) + the Pre-Check Webster pack image-analysis. Prompts and contextual data are sent on each request; Anthropic does not store or use these for model training under their commercial terms. Pharmacy owners can disable in Pharmacy Settings → AI Chat. |
| Twilio Inc. United States · global |
SMS sending + receiving | Outbound SMS to patients (delivery / collection notifications, holiday-hours cohort SMS, sick-call notifications), inbound SMS replies (auto-handled STOP, manual replies). Each SMS includes the recipient phone number + message body in the Twilio request. |
These process data only when a pharmacy explicitly enables the relevant integration. If your pharmacy hasn't enabled the integration, none of your data flows to that provider.

| Pharmacy Programs Administrator (PPA) Per-claim Australia |
8CPA claim submission | When you submit a MedsCheck, NIPVIP, CVCP, DAA, or Staged Supply claim via Pharmacy HQ, patient identifiers (name, DOB, Medicare/DVA), vaccine batch/lot data, and the service particulars are sent to PPA under your existing Service Provider Agreement. Pharmacy HQ is a technical conduit; the data relationship is between you and PPA. |
| Xero When connected New Zealand |
Payroll integration | When you connect Xero via OAuth (Pharmacy Settings → Integrations → Xero), approved timesheet data + staff identity fields are pushed to Xero on demand. Pharmacy HQ does not pull data from Xero. Disconnect at any time in Pharmacy Settings. |
| Google Maps Platform When enabled United States · global |
Geocoding + route optimisation | When you enable Deliveries route optimisation (Pharmacy Settings → Integrations → Google Maps), delivery addresses are geocoded via Google's Geocoding API + routed via the Directions API. Address strings are sent; no patient names. Per-pharmacy opt-in + monthly call budget. |
| Google My Business API When connected United States · global |
Trading-hours sync | If you connect your Google Business Profile (Pharmacy Settings → Integrations → GMB), Pharmacy HQ pushes public-holiday hours updates to GMB on your behalf. Read-write OAuth scope. |
These handle enquiries from our public website only. They never receive pharmacy, staff or patient data, no record from inside Pharmacy HQ passes to them.

| Calendly LLC United States |
Walkthrough bookings | Booking a walkthrough on pharmacyhq.com.au uses an embedded Calendly scheduler. Calendly receives the name, email address and chosen time entered on that form, plus anything typed into its own fields, and it sets cookies in the visitor's browser. It is loaded only on the pages that offer a booking, and only when that section is scrolled into view. No pharmacy account, staff record or patient information is involved at any point. |
Under the Australian Privacy Act, we are required to disclose where personal information crosses national borders. The tables above identify the primary jurisdiction of each sub-processor, including the website-only provider, whose data is limited to enquiry details a visitor types themselves. Where a US-based sub-processor has Australian or regional infrastructure (Google Cloud, Cloudflare, Twilio), processing may occur in those regions; data still crosses into US-controlled infrastructure for replication, billing, or support purposes.
We do not transfer personal information to any sub-processor whose primary jurisdiction is the United Kingdom, the European Union, or jurisdictions without an adequate-protection finding under Australian privacy law, except to the extent the US-based providers above maintain edge infrastructure in those regions for performance reasons.
Material changes to this list (adding a new always-on sub-processor, or expanding the data category a current sub-processor handles) are reflected here. The "Last updated" date at the top of this page changes on each edit.
Banner-group customers and pharmacies with a signed Data Processing Agreement may request 30 days' advance notice on material changes; the standard subscriber tier does not include this commitment.
